1. Scroll down to find the entries: network.http.pipelining, network.http.proxy.pipelining, network.http.pipelining.maxrequests.(Normally the browser will make one request to a web page at a time. When you enable pipelining it will make several at once, which really speeds up page loading.)
2. Alter the entries as follows: Set "network.http.pipelining" to "true". Set "network.http.proxy.pipelining" to "true". Set "network.http.pipelining.maxrequests" to 8. This means it will make 8 requests at once.
3. Right-click anywhere on the screen and select New-> Integer.
4. Name it "nglayout.initialpaint.delay"(without quotes) and set its value to "0". This value is the amount of time the browser waits before it acts on information it receives.
